Abstract:
Allowyn and Bacon states that Education should help the child to adjust himself/herself physically and mentally to his/her environment and to the changing circumstances in his/her life. Education means the modification of behavior of the student in relation to the existing social conditions. Education on the one hand, develops the full personality of an individual-making him intelligent, learned, bold, courageous and strong 2 with good character and on the other hand, it contributes to the growth and development of the Nation in general and the society in particular. Every human being, especially every child, has a right to education, to knowledge and to learn. The acquisition of knowledge and information helps an individual to improve his/her own quality of life as well as to participate meaningfully in community life. The growth of the child and learning of the child will depend on the effectiveness of the school. So, this research paper can give analysis, “A study on the attitude of teachers on the effectiveness of state and central government schoolsâ€
